Story-line:
Brahmarambha (Rakul Preet Singh) is a lovely village girl who comes to the city promising her mother she will never fall in love and will only marry the guy chosen by her father (Sampath Raj). She meets Siva (Naga Chaitanya) in Hero's friend Vennala Kishore's marriage. She moves with him to a condition that he should never propose to her. Even though Siva agrees, he could not resist but then could not propose to her due to the condition. Rest of the story is all about what happens in their love story.


Performances:
Naga Chaitanya and Rakul Preet Singh are the major attractions for the film. Major scenes in the film have screen space of Naga Chaitanya and Rakul Preet Singh.Naga Chaitanya delivered impressive performance throughout the film. Rakul Preet plays a village girl role. She has more space to showcase her talent and she did with an ease. But in some scenes, you can feel why she acts more than what her role requires. Her looks in traditional wear is good. The chemistry between them is excellent. Senior Actors Jagapathi Babu and Sampath Raj are superb in their father's roles. All comedians wasted in this films as not so great comedy generated by them except Vennela Kishore. Kishore role gives some laughs here and there. Rest of characters Benarji, Chalapathi Rao, Annapurna, Kaumadi supports the film.

Analysis:
Director Kalyan Krishna does a decent job. This movie would be better or perfect if he concentrates only on content, not commercial elements by adding of unwanted comedy bits except Vennala Kishore's role. Somehow, you can feel that director is trying to imitate Krishna Vamshi kind of taking. The family emotions give us an okay feel. 



Technical Values:
Devi Sri Prasad's music is good. Songs are good and well picturized. Rerecording matches the moto. SV Visweshwar's camera work is good. He showed the beautiful locations of Vizag and village beauty with his lens. Every frame is colorful. Editing by Gautham Raju should have been better in the second half. Few Dialogues are good. Especially dialogues while the breakup scenes happened between lead pair are awesome and will get big applause from viewers. Production values of Annapurna Studios are in rich.

Story-line:



Keshava (Nikhil) loses his parents in a car accident in his childhood. He lives with his sister. Keshava suffers from a rare heart disease as his heart on the right side and should always keep his anger or tension in check. Any mental or physical tension will ruin his health. In this situation, he goes on a killing spree and rest is all about what happens forms the story.








Performances:

Nikhil came up with an intense performance in a role which is keen on revenge for his parent's death. Throughout the film, Nikhil totally settled in his character. Hero character requires to be serious, he acted with an ease with a serious note.  Isha Koppikar in her comeback as an IPS Officer makes a stunning comeback. Ritu Varma is good in the short role. Vennela Kishore is excellent with his typical comedy timing and expressions. Priyadarshi is just okay in a limited role. Anchor anusuya bharadwaj voice completely suits to her. Others like Rao Ramesh, Ajay, Brahmaji, Raja Ravindra are good in their roles.

Analysis:

Director Sudheer Varma handled the revenge drama in a stylish manner.  First and foremost is director succeeded by not encouraging unnecessary commercial elements in the film like item songs, love songs between lead pair etc except very few forced comedy bits. Keshava is a Crime Thriller which has got a simple story but runs completely on the screenplay. 

The Right Side Heart Disorder of Nikhil has got nothing to the story as mainly focused in trailers. Elevating the movie with this problem would have given a different shape to the film but the director Sudheer Varma haven't focused on it. And producers and director used that point in film's promotions cleverly. There are other things which would have been good if addressed properly. 






Technical Values:

Sunny's music is good. Prashant Pillai’s Background score is hunting and terrific. Diwakar Mani’s Cinematography is top notch and the lighting gives an intense feel while watching the film. Editing is good and Few Dialogues are good. Production Values of Abhishek Pictures are good.
